Autumn is the time of the year when the days grow shorter, the weather turns cooler, and the trees begin to change color. It’s also the season for delicious autumn vegetables and greens that provide a bounty of nutrients and flavors.

Autumn vegetables and greens are not only great for your health, but they also add an amazing depth of color and flavor to your meals. Here are some of the best autumn vegetables and greens that you should try this season:

1. Brussels Sprouts

Brussels sprouts are one of the most popular autumn vegetables because they are rich in vitamins and minerals such as vitamin C, vitamin K, and folate. These cruciferous vegetables have a slightly bitter taste which makes them perfect for roasting. To roast them, simply cut them in half, season them with salt, pepper and olive oil, and roast in the oven until tender.

2. Butternut Squash

Butternut squash is another great autumn vegetable that is perfect for soups, stews, and roasted dishes. It’s packed with vitamins A and C, potassium, and fiber, making it a great addition to a healthy diet. The sweet and nutty flavor of butternut squash pairs well with savory dishes, making it a versatile ingredient.

3. Sweet Potatoes

The orange-fleshed sweet potato is a popular fall vegetable that is packed with complex carbohydrates that provide energy and fiber. It’s also rich in vitamins A, C, and B6, as well as potassium and iron. Roast them, mash them, or make a sweet potato casserole – there are plenty of ways to enjoy this sweet and nutritious vegetable.

4. Kale

Kale is a nutrient-dense green that is great for autumn salads, soup, stir-fry, and juicing. It’s rich in vitamins A, C, and K, as well as antioxidants and fiber. The hearty and slightly bitter flavor of kale makes it perfect for savory dishes, and it pairs well with other autumn vegetables.

5. Pumpkins

Pumpkins are the quintessential fall vegetable and can be used in both sweet and savory dishes. The flesh is high in vitamin A, fiber, and antioxidants, and the seeds are a good source of protein and healthy fats. Roasting or baking a pumpkin is easy, and the results are a delicious and nutritious addition to any meal.

6. Beets

Beets have a unique and earthy flavor that is perfect for autumn salads, soups, and roasted dishes. They are packed with vitamins and minerals such as potassium, iron, and vitamin C. Roasting beets gives them a slightly sweet and caramelized flavor that pairs well with other autumn vegetables.

7. Spinach

Spinach is a versatile and nutrient-dense green that can be used in a wide variety of autumn dishes. It’s an excellent source of vitamins A and C, iron, and calcium. Whether in a salad, soup, or sautéed with other vegetables, spinach adds a rich flavor and a beautiful green color to any dish.

In conclusion, autumn vegetables and greens are a nutritious and flavorful addition to any meal. They provide a wide range of v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ants that are essential for maintaining good health. Whether roasted, mashed, or used in a salad, autumn vegetables and greens offer a unique and delicious flavor that can’t be beaten.
